H5 page production refers to the creation of cross-platform compatible web pages using technologies such as HTML5, CSS3 and JavaScript. Its core lies in the browser's parsing code, rendering structure, style and interactive functions. Common technologies include animation effects, responsive design, and data interaction. To avoid errors, developers should be debugged; performance optimization and best practices include image format optimization, request reduction and code specifications, etc. to improve loading speed and code quality.
What exactly does H5 page production mean? Simply put, it is to use the three musketeers of HTML5, CSS3 and JavaScript to build web pages that can run well on both the mobile and PC sides. But don't be blinded by this simple definition, the water here is deep!
In this article, I will take you to dig through the inside and out of H5 page production, from basic concepts to advanced skills, and even some unknown pitfalls, so that you can avoid detours and become an expert in H5 page production. After reading it, you can not only complete an H5 page independently, but also understand the design concepts and technical details behind it.
Let’s start with the basics. HTML5, you know, the skeleton of the web page is responsible for the page structure; CSS3, the clothes of the web page are responsible for the page style; JavaScript, the soul of the web page is responsible for the page interaction and dynamic effects. All three are indispensable, just like the human body needs bones, muscles and nervous system. Don’t underestimate these foundations. Only solid foundations can support tall buildings. Many beginners like to be eager to achieve success and directly get started with complex frameworks and libraries, but often result in half the result with twice the effort. It is recommended to practice these three things to perfection first, and then consider others.
Now let's dive into the core of the H5 page: how it works. To put it bluntly, the browser parses HTML, CSS, and JavaScript code, and then renders the page you see. HTML defines the structure of page elements, CSS defines the style of elements, and JavaScript controls the behavior of elements. This process seems simple, but it involves many complex algorithms and optimization strategies, such as how browsers build and render DOM trees, how to handle JavaScript event loops, etc. Understanding these principles will allow you to write more efficient and elegant code.
Next, let’s look at a few examples. A simple H5 page may only require a few divs and some simple styles to achieve. But a complex H5 page may require a variety of technologies, such as animation effects, responsive design, data interaction, etc.
For example, a simple login page:
<code class="html"> <title>登录页面</title> <style> body { font-family: sans-serif; } form { display: flex; flex-direction: column; width: 300px; margin: 0 auto; } label, input { margin-bottom: 10px; } button { padding: 10px; background-color: #4CAF50; color: white; border: none; cursor: pointer; } </style> <form> <label for="username">用户名:</label> <input type="text" id="username" name="username"> <label for="password">密码:</label> <input type="password" id="password" name="password"> <button type="submit">登录</button> </form> </code>
This code is concise and clear, but if you want to implement more advanced features, such as form verification, asynchronous requests, etc., you need to use JavaScript. Remember that the readability and maintainability of the code are very important, don't write code that is difficult to understand. Good code style, annotations, and modular design can save you a lot of effort in maintaining code in the future.
Let’s talk about common errors and debugging techniques. Many beginners are prone to making mistakes, which are to forget to close the tag, or to write the CSS selector incorrectly. At this time, the browser's developer tools come in handy. Learning to use developer tools can help you quickly locate and solve problems. Remember, debugging is a must-have skill for a programmer.
Finally, performance optimization and best practices. An efficient H5 page should load quickly and run smoothly. This requires us to optimize the code, such as using the appropriate image format, reducing the number of HTTP requests, using cache, etc. In addition, good programming habits, such as code specifications, modular design, unit testing, etc., can also improve code quality and maintainability. Remember, writing code is like building a house. The firmer the foundation is, the higher the house can be built. Don’t be rushing to achieve success. Only by stepping one step can you become a real H5 page making expert.
The above is the detailed content of What exactly does H5 page production mean?. For more information, please follow other related articles on the PHP Chinese website!

MicrodatainHTML5enhancesSEOanduserexperiencebyprovidingstructureddatatosearchengines.1)Useitemscope,itemtype,anditempropattributestomarkupcontentlikeproductsorevents.2)TestmicrodatawithtoolslikeGoogle'sStructuredDataTestingTool.3)ConsiderusingJSON-LD

HTML5introducesnewinputtypesthatenhanceuserexperience,simplifydevelopment,andimproveaccessibility.1)automaticallyvalidatesemailformat.2)optimizesformobilewithanumerickeypad.3)andsimplifydateandtimeinputs,reducingtheneedforcustomsolutions.

H5 is HTML5, the fifth version of HTML. HTML5 improves the expressiveness and interactivity of web pages, introduces new features such as semantic tags, multimedia support, offline storage and Canvas drawing, and promotes the development of Web technology.

Accessibility and compliance with network standards are essential to the website. 1) Accessibility ensures that all users have equal access to the website, 2) Network standards follow to improve accessibility and consistency of the website, 3) Accessibility requires the use of semantic HTML, keyboard navigation, color contrast and alternative text, 4) Following these principles is not only a moral and legal requirement, but also amplifying user base.

The H5 tag in HTML is a fifth-level title that is used to tag smaller titles or sub-titles. 1) The H5 tag helps refine content hierarchy and improve readability and SEO. 2) Combined with CSS, you can customize the style to enhance the visual effect. 3) Use H5 tags reasonably to avoid abuse and ensure the logical content structure.

The methods of building a website in HTML5 include: 1. Use semantic tags to define the web page structure, such as, , etc.; 2. Embed multimedia content, use and tags; 3. Apply advanced functions such as form verification and local storage. Through these steps, you can create a modern web page with clear structure and rich features.

A reasonable H5 code structure allows the page to stand out among a lot of content. 1) Use semantic labels such as, etc. to organize content to make the structure clear. 2) Control the rendering effect of pages on different devices through CSS layout such as Flexbox or Grid. 3) Implement responsive design to ensure that the page adapts to different screen sizes.

The main differences between HTML5 (H5) and older versions of HTML include: 1) H5 introduces semantic tags, 2) supports multimedia content, and 3) provides offline storage functions. H5 enhances the functionality and expressiveness of web pages through new tags and APIs, such as and tags, improving user experience and SEO effects, but need to pay attention to compatibility issues.


Hot AI Tools

Undresser.AI Undress
AI-powered app for creating realistic nude photos

AI Clothes Remover
Online AI tool for removing clothes from photos.

Undress AI Tool
Undress images for free

Clothoff.io
AI clothes remover

Video Face Swap
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Article

Hot Tools

SublimeText3 Linux new version
SublimeText3 Linux latest version

MantisBT
Mantis is an easy-to-deploy web-based defect tracking tool designed to aid in product defect tracking. It requires PHP, MySQL and a web server. Check out our demo and hosting services.

Zend Studio 13.0.1
Powerful PHP integrated development environment

SAP NetWeaver Server Adapter for Eclipse
Integrate Eclipse with SAP NetWeaver application server.

VSCode Windows 64-bit Download
A free and powerful IDE editor launched by Microsoft
